**Salmonella Paratyphi A vaccine** refers to investigational vaccines targeting *Salmonella enterica* serovar Paratyphi A, the primary cause of paratyphoid fever, a form of enteric fever affecting over 2 million people annually, mainly in Asia and Africa via contaminated food and water. The leading candidate, **CVD 1902**, is a live-attenuated oral vaccine developed at the University of Maryland, expressing key antigens like O lipopolysaccharide and FliC flagellin to induce humoral (IgG/IgA) and cellular (CD4+/CD8+ T-cell) immunity mimicking natural infection while attenuating virulence. In a phase 2b human challenge trial, two oral doses demonstrated **73% vaccine efficacy** against controlled *S. Paratyphi A* exposure, with a favorable safety profile (mild GI events like nausea predominant). No licensed vaccine exists; CVD 1902 is licensed to Bharat Biotech for potential bivalent development with *S. Typhi* vaccines to comprehensively prevent enteric fever.
